For the past decade, car insides have actually been quickly developing towards smooth, screen-dominated control board. Touchscreens replaced typical knobs, sliders, and switches in what several thought was the unpreventable march of progress. Yet, in an unexpected twist, physical buttons are quietly making their back right into contemporary automobiles. The change signals greater than just a classic nod-- it's a response to real-world comments from chauffeurs desire simplicity, safety and security, and responsive satisfaction.



The Digital Overload Dilemma



When touchscreens initially started taking control of control panels, they felt like the future: clean, personalized, and filled with features. They got rid of clutter and permitted car manufacturers to improve their insides with less physical components. However as more features were buried within digital food selections, chauffeurs started to voice issues.



Touchscreens frequently need numerous actions to execute standard jobs like adjusting the environment or changing the radio terminal. Unlike switches, they do not have the intuitive muscular tissue memory that permits a chauffeur to alter a setting without taking their eyes off the road. With a lot occurring on-screen, it becomes all as well easy to obtain sidetracked-- something nobody desires when traveling at freeway rates.



The Return of Tactile Functionality



Among the biggest advantages of switches is their responsive responses. You can feel them without requiring to look. This sensory support makes them not simply hassle-free but safer for drivers. When your hand intuitively knows where the volume handle is or exactly how much to push a switch to trigger the defrost, it minimizes the need to look down or far from the road. And while touchscreens provide benefit for infotainment and navigation, the important everyday functions-- like threat lights, audio controls, and HVAC-- really feel better suited to physical controls.



Actually, many chauffeurs that formerly swore by digital systems have actually shared admiration for more recent designs that blend modern-day visual appeals with the useful feeling of typical controls. It's not regarding declining development-- it's about improving usability.



A Balanced Design Philosophy



Developers have taken notice of this changing view. Rather than deserting screens, they're reconsidering exactly how they're incorporated. The best insides now strike an equilibrium between digital adaptability and analog precision. That indicates tactically positioning buttons for crucial functions while utilizing digital user interfaces for applications, navigating, and media.



This hybrid method is specifically preferred in automobiles designed for long-distance driving or family members. The simplicity of pressing a button without messing up through a food selection makes a big difference when you're attempting to stay concentrated, comfortable, and secure. Also in cars recognized for cutting-edge technology, a basic rotary dial or responsive control can be the feature that sways drivers searching for thoughtful layout.



Buttons and the Emotional Connection



There's also something distinctively psychological regarding buttons. They bring a specific degree of engagement that touchscreens just don't replicate. Pushing a button or turning a dial feels like you're literally connecting with your vehicle-- it includes a layer of connection that makes the driving experience a lot more pleasurable.
